Output ab3d0aada632f233ea58edd4690058c6d0e7c11a396569d756bdc4d95103bf77:0

value
6243592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d4dad3c1fcae2ac01b05d84eab34421c7d0298 OP_EQUAL
address
323GwXfn1jZJAoBkto7M17gBKkquiEmw1C
transaction
ab3d0aada632f233ea58edd4690058c6d0e7c11a396569d756bdc4d95103bf77
spent
true